The Importance of Using a Crime Map in Browndale

Crime maps serve as vital tools for understanding the safety landscape of Browndale. They help residents identify patterns and hotspots of criminal activity, allowing for better planning and community engagement:

  • Identify Crime Clusters: Spot areas with higher incidences of theft, vandalism, or other crimes.
  • Enhance Personal Safety: Use data to choose safer routes and neighborhoods.
  • Stay Updated: Receive real-time alerts about recent incidents.
  • Foster Community Vigilance: Collaborate with neighbors to improve safety efforts.

Tips for Staying Safe in Browndale

Beyond monitoring crime maps, residents can take proactive steps to enhance safety:

  • Stay Informed: Regularly review the crime map and local news updates.
  • Report Suspicious Activity: Contact the Gwinnett County Police at their official site to report concerns.
  • Community Engagement: Participate in neighborhood watch programs and safety meetings.
  • Secure Your Property: Use locks, security systems, and outdoor lighting to deter crime.
